Customer Engagement Manager Jobs in Texas: Frequently Asked Questions
How do you become a customer engagement manager in Texas?
Most Texas employers expect a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or communications alongside direct experience in customer-facing roles such as account management or customer success. There is no state-issued license required to work in this role in Texas. Building experience in CRM tools like Salesforce, earning a Customer Success Association certification, and progressing through support or account coordinator roles at Texas-based tech or financial firms are the most common paths into the position.

Are there remote customer engagement manager jobs in Texas?
Yes, and more than most fields. Customer engagement manager work is largely desk-based and communication-driven, which makes it well suited to remote arrangements. About 33% of customer engagement manager openings tied to Texas are remote or hybrid as of August 2026. Client success and onboarding-focused roles tend to be the most remote-eligible, while positions tied to on-site enterprise accounts or field-based relationship management are more likely to require in-person presence.
How can I get hired as a customer engagement manager in Texas with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path is moving into the role from a customer support, inside sales, or account coordinator position at a Texas-based technology or financial services company. Large Texas employers such as Dell Technologies, AT&T, and regional SaaS firms regularly hire for associate customer success or client onboarding roles that feed into customer engagement manager tracks. Completing a Customer Success Association certification or building a portfolio showing measurable client outcomes gives candidates a clear edge when applying without direct management experience.
